:: Then boat is hull number 561. I purchased it from a
:: fellow in the
:: central valley that had it stored in a very dry, very
:: warm storage
:: area for years. The result was that when I brought it to
:: the bay, it
:: was probably the lightest, stiffest Santana in the
:: fleet. Before
:: being moth balled for several years, the boat was sailed
:: up on a
:: fresh water lake above modesto and probably never saw
:: more than 10
:: knots of wind. I brought the boat down and updated the
:: rigging and
:: put a new set of sails on it. Most of the running
:: rigging is low
:: stretch vectran or dyneema with all modern blocks. The
:: upwind sails
:: are the standard pineapples with a full top batten main.
:: The jib has
:: only been used at 2 Nationals and 1 Vallejo race which
:: is 5 days.
:: The main has slightly more use, but has excellent shape.
:: The boat is
:: a bit oxidized like all of the old boats, and is not the
:: prettiest
:: thing in the world but it is one of the fastest boats in
:: the Bay.
:: The bottom and Keel are not the prettiest, but the boat
:: has no
:: shortage of speed having finished in the top 5 in the
:: Nationals for
:: the 2 years it attended (4th in Santa Cruz in '05 and
:: 5th in '07).
:: Actually, excluding the new boats, It has placed as the
:: top Bay Area
:: boat in both the Nationals it has raced in. The rudder
:: is pretty
:: fair and the edges are very sharp with minimal hull gap.
::
:: The controls are lead back to the cockpit and all work
:: exceptionally
:: well. I put a lot of time placing the jib cars to get
:: the optimal
:: jib shape and sheeting angle. The standing rigging is
:: the standard
:: Bay Area heavy air setup and is in good shape. The
:: headstay is set
:: up for max class legal rake and the boat sails with very
:: neutral
:: helm. For some reason we have not experienced the lee
:: helm that the
:: tuna is famous for. The boat is setup for a spinnaker
:: with very good
:: fredriksen sheeting blocks. It has a brand new North 2S
:: which has
:: only been hoisted once. I have done some testing and I
:: believe the
:: north kite is faster than the pineapple in everything
:: but super deep
:: running. It has a bit less shoulder than the pinapple
:: and can be
:: carried a good 5-10 degrees higher than the bigger
:: shouldered kites.
:: It is really a great vallejo or point to point type "in
:: the bay"
:: kite. In all, this boat is a great boat for someone who
:: wants to go
:: fast right away. Being a very stiff hull to start with,
:: the boat is
:: also perfect candidate for someone looking to do a
:: restoration if
:: they want it to be cosmetically perfect.
